Output 5477bb563286588818726082e2ee6fcd672de9cb45373b11e7b6e9d4d6c53d18:66

value
157600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8939f42bf5aca8549ee17ba1e07b685cbb04ff51 OP_EQUAL
address
3ECbvXPq5MY4GEpik1KfhoUEhYSm6DUdix
transaction
5477bb563286588818726082e2ee6fcd672de9cb45373b11e7b6e9d4d6c53d18
spent
true